## Authentication

The breaker wrapper around the Fernwick upstream API needs creds even in half-open probe mode — probes count as real calls, so don't mock them out in review. Trip threshold is five failures per minute, and recovery probes fire every 20 seconds. All probe traffic authenticates against the internal Fernwick gateway with the key below.

API key for yahig-tadup: kto7_ubizbYm

Welcome aboard! One of your weekly duties is shipping the fleet fuel-usage report that Haulwise ops leans on every Monday. The numbers come from our internal Tankmetry service, which aggregates pump logs across the Caldermoor depots. Don't hand-edit the CSVs — if something looks off, rerun the aggregation job instead. The report generator runs under the release pipeline, so you'll trigger it from there. To pull data locally for spot checks, authenticate with the key below.

gateway credential: kto3_qfe

Break-glass access — Hookstream delivery. Welcome aboard. Webhooks retry with exponential backoff: 5 attempts over 2 hours, then dead-letter. If the retry scheduler wedges and normal admin auth is down, use break-glass on the Hookstream console. That path requires the recovery passphrase, which is recorded immediately below this line.

unlock words, yawig-kagef: gordor-holvan-ulaael-pramir-ulaiel-tamdor